在HarmonyOS NEXT开发中自定义弹窗是否可以不绑定 this ?
在HarmonyOS NEXT开发中,自定义弹窗可以不绑定 this
。具体实现方式取决于你如何设计和实现弹窗组件。在JavaScript或TypeScript中,如果你使用函数式组件或者通过其他方式管理状态(例如使用全局状态管理库),你可以避免直接使用 this
来引用组件实例。然而,如果你使用的是类组件,通常需要通过 this
来访问组件的状态和方法。
一种常见的做法是使用函数式组件和Hooks(如果HarmonyOS NEXT支持类似React的Hooks机制),这样可以减少或避免使用 this
。如果HarmonyOS NEXT的组件框架提供了类似的机制,你可以参考相关文档来实现这一点。
1 回答433 阅读
394 阅读
1 回答350 阅读✓ 已解决
389 阅读
306 阅读
340 阅读
354 阅读
可以尝试将弹窗设置成全局,可以不使用this
自定义弹窗不需要绑定this